Acquires knowledge or skill through study, experience, or teaching; gains understanding of something.
From Old English 'leornian,' related to Germanic roots meaning 'to follow a track' or 'to learn by experience.' The sense of 'becoming skilled' evolved from the idea of following a path of instruction.
The original meaning was about following a track, which is a beautiful metaphor for how learning works—you're literally following a path someone else has walked down before you.
